OK - given the wet summer we've had, some might think we were being slightly optimistic, but the clever design of the panels as tubes gives an increased surface area to make the most of any available UV radiation, meaning that even on overcast days there's some degree of water heating.
We also had the hot water cylinder upgraded to a massive 300 litre capacity.
Initial verdict - well we've had a couple of weeks of September sunshine and the 2 panels have managed to heat the cylinder to an impressive 65C over a day. So we're happy with it.
